I don't know about you, but I think that hand wired projects are super cool, and I want to encourage more people to do hand wired projects! Anyway, One of the best controllers that money can buy is the teensy 2.0. It's convenient, it's, well, teensy, and it is compatible with TMK. Teensy's are pretty cheap in the first place, that's true. That being said, if you're anything like me, you like to keep two or three of the things on hand. Now necessarily for keyboard related stuff, but they are something that's handy to have.

Anyway, I had this idea that we could organize a group buy for a bunch of teensy 2.0's. I emailed Robin at PJRC (The manufacturers of Teensy products, as well as a few other cool things) last night, and she got back to me this morning with the following pricing:
Teensy 2.0, Without Pins
Qty 1 - 24: $16.00
Qty 25 - 99: $14.40
Qty 100: $12.80

I don't know if there could be more price drops after 100, since I really only asked for the 100 or so mark, since I don't really expect this buy to be all that big.

One other thing I was thinking, if the community would be interested, is adding wire and diodes to the buy, so that we can have everything we need (minus switches and plates, which, for custom builds are more of a source it yourself kind of thing anyway) to build some hand wired boards!

Please post your thoughts and suggestions in this thread!
